4. Setup and Initial Charge
4.1 Charging the Power Bank
Before first use, fully charge your FOREVER MATB-100 Power Bank.
- Connect the provided USB-C cable to the USB-C port on the power bank.
- Connect the other end of the USB-C cable to a compatible USB wall adapter (not included). For optimal charging speed, use a Power Delivery (PD) compatible adapter.
- The LED indicators will illuminate to show the charging progress. When all LEDs are solid, the power bank is fully charged.
Note: The power bank can be charged using the USB-C port. It is recommended to fully charge the power bank every three months if not in regular use to maintain battery health.
5. Operating Instructions
5.1 Checking Battery Level
Press the power button once to check the remaining battery level. The LED indicators will light up, with each LED representing approximately 25% of the battery capacity.
5.2 Wireless Charging
The MATB-100 supports wireless charging for compatible devices, including MagSafe-enabled iPhones and other Qi-compatible smartphones.
- Ensure the power bank is sufficiently charged.
- Place your wireless charging compatible device onto the wireless charging pad of the power bank. For MagSafe-enabled devices, the power bank will magnetically align.
- The device should begin charging automatically. If not, press the power button on the power bank to activate wireless charging.
- The LED indicators on the power bank may show charging status.

Image 5.1: A smartphone attached to the power bank, illustrating wireless charging in progress and icons representing Quick Charge, Power Delivery, and various wattage outputs.
Tip: Use the integrated kickstand to prop up your phone while it charges wirelessly, allowing for comfortable viewing.
5.3 Wired Charging (USB-A and USB-C)
The power bank can charge devices via its USB-A and USB-C ports.
- Ensure the power bank is sufficiently charged.
- Connect one end of a compatible charging cable to your device and the other end to either the USB-A or USB-C output port on the power bank.
- The device should begin charging automatically. If not, press the power button on the power bank.

Image 5.2: A smartphone connected to the power bank via a USB-C cable, demonstrating wired charging.
Note: The USB-C port functions as both an input for charging the power bank and an output for charging other devices. The USB-A port is an output only.
5.4 Simultaneous Charging
The FOREVER MATB-100 can charge up to three devices simultaneously (one wirelessly, one via USB-A, and one via USB-C). The total output power will be distributed among the connected devices.

7. Troubleshooting
7.1 Power Bank Not Charging
- Ensure the USB-C cable is securely connected to both the power bank and the wall adapter.
- Verify that the wall adapter is functioning correctly and plugged into a live power outlet.
- Try using a different USB-C cable and/or wall adapter.
7.2 Device Not Charging from Power Bank
- Check the power bank's battery level. If it's low, recharge the power bank.
- Press the power button on the power bank to activate charging.
- For wired charging, ensure the cable is securely connected to both the power bank and your device. Try a different cable or port.
- For wireless charging, ensure your device is properly aligned on the charging pad and is wireless charging compatible. Remove any thick cases that might interfere.
- Ensure there are no metallic objects between the power bank and your device during wireless charging.
7.3 Slow Charging
- Ensure you are using a high-quality, compatible charging cable.
- For wired charging, ensure your device supports Quick Charge (QC) or Power Delivery (PD) if you expect fast charging speeds.
- For wireless charging, ensure your device supports fast wireless charging and is correctly aligned.
- Charging multiple devices simultaneously may reduce the charging speed for each individual device.
8. Specifications
| Model Name | MATB-100 |
| Brand | FOREVER |
| Battery Capacity | 10000 mAh (Milliampere-hour) |
| Battery Composition | Lithium-ion |
| Connector Type | USB Type A, USB Type C |
| Special Feature | Wireless Charging, Magnetic Grip, Integrated Kickstand |
| Voltage | 5 Volts (Output) |
| Number of Ports | 2 (USB-A, USB-C) + Wireless Charging |
| Compatible Devices | Smartphones (including MagSafe compatible), Tablets, Headphones, Smartwatches |
| Dimensions (L x W x H) | 10.8 cm x 6.8 cm x 2 cm (approximate) |
| Max Wireless Output | 15W |
| Max USB-A Output | 22.5W (Quick Charge) |
| Max USB-C Output | 20W (Power Delivery) |
9. Safety Information
- Do not disassemble, open, or shred the battery pack.
- Do not expose the power bank to heat or fire. Avoid storage in direct sunlight.
- Do not short-circuit the power bank. Do not store battery packs haphazardly in a box or drawer where they may short-circuit each other or be short-circuited by conductive materials.
- Do not subject the power bank to mechanical shock.
- In the event of a battery leak, do not allow the liquid to come into contact with the skin or eyes. If contact has been made, wash the affected area with copious amounts of water and seek medical advice.
- Keep the power bank out of reach of children.
- Supervise children when using the power bank.
- Do not use any charger other than that specifically provided for use with the equipment.
- Dispose of the power bank properly according to local regulations. Do not dispose of with household waste.
